Evaluation and optimization of DNA extraction and purification procedures for soil and sediment samples

D N Miller1, J E Bryant, E L Madsen

  • 1Section of Microbiology, Division of Biological Sciences, Cornell University, Ithaca, New York 14853-8101, USA. miller@email.marc.usda.gov

Summary

Optimizing DNA extraction from soil and sediment involves bead mill homogenization with SDS and chloroform, followed by Sephadex G-200 purification. This method maximizes DNA yield and molecular size, crucial for molecular analyses.
